A fantastic one-bedroom flat occupying part of the rear of the third floor of this stunning period property, situated in this extremely sought-after position in Brunswick Square, adjacent to Hove seafront.

The property occupies part of the rear of the third floor of this amazing period building in central Hove, with beautiful and extremely well-maintained communal hallways as well as a passenger lift to all floors. The accommodation itself comprises an entrance hall with storage cupboard, modern bathroom, kitchen, living/dining room, and good-sized double bedroom. The property benefits from a share of freehold and is offered for sale with no onward chain.

Brunswick Square in Hove is a prestigious location known for its historical charm and elegant Regency-style architecture. Near the seafront, it offers residents a vibrant community with cafes, restaurants, and boutique shops. Convenient transport options make exploring Hove and Brighton easy, while the nearby beach promenade is perfect for leisurely walks and sea views. Brunswick Square blends historical significance with modern convenience, making it a sought-after place to live.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
